Racing: Nicholls says that Business is booming
The King George VI Chase winner, See More Business, delighted Paul Nicholls in work yesterday and is on course for the Pillar Chase at Cheltenham on Saturday week. Opponents are likely to include Addington Boy, Barton Bank and Rough Quest in what connections view as a dress rehearsal for the Gold Cup.
"We've had no problems since the King George," Nicholls said. "He's going to have only one run before the Gold Cup as his confidence is high now."
Andrew Thornton rode See More Business on Boxing Day, but the gelding is to be reunited with Timmy Murphy, who was denied the ride at Kempton because of a whip ban. "Timmy did all the hard work with the horse, getting his jumping sorted out, it's only right that he rides," Nicholls said. "You never know, `See More' might repay him by winning a big prize."
Alabang, third in the William Hill Handicap Hurdle at Sandown, has been installed favourite with the sponsors for the Tote Lanzarote Hurdle at Kempton on Saturday.
